Awkward wording[edit]

"Despite some statements according to which Ion Zelea Codreanu was originally a Slav of Ukrainian or Polish origin."
Could this be integrated in another sentence?--Adûnâi (talk) 00:42, 26 February 2018 (UTC)[reply]

Many people thought that he was a "Slav" due to his "Zelinski" name. When Bukovina was under Polish administration (belonging to the province of Galicia), his paternal grandfather was forced by authorities to change his name from Zelea to Zelinski.

Corneliu Zelea Codreanu's birth certificate[edit]

The website https://www.marturisitorii.ro/2018/03/22/premiera-arhivele-nationale-publica-actul-de-nastere-al-capitanului-miscarii-legionare-corneliu-zelea-codreanu-extras-din-registrului-starii-civile-iasi-din-septembrie-1899-document/ contains photos with Corneliu Zelea Codreanu's original birth certificate, which says that its birth name is Corneliu Codreanu, not Corneliu Zelinski. The birth certificate has been published by Iasi National Archives on March 20, 2018 and it's written in an old dialect of Romanian language.
